Great thread! that dragonfly pic is incredible. can you tell us what camera and lens you were using?

Thanks! that's encouraging. for this pic, I used a Canon 40D, Lens Canon 100-400mm with Kenko Extension tubes. It's sorta my poor mans macro lens :) The combination works great and using a big zoom lens with extension tubes gives you a lot of working distance.
